What is an online CRM system?
An online CRM system is a cloud-based software solution designed to manage and analyze a company's interactions with its customers. It provides a centralized database that stores customer information, such as contact details, purchase history, and communication history. Online CRM systems are accessible from anywhere with an internet connection, making it easy for sales teams to access customer data while on the go.
Benefits of using an online CRM system
There are several benefits to using an online CRM system, including:
1. Cost-effective
Online CRM systems are typically more cost-effective than traditional on-premise solutions. Since they are cloud-based, there is no need for businesses to invest in expensive hardware or software to run the system. Additionally, online CRM systems often offer flexible pricing plans, making it easier for businesses to find a solution that fits their budget.
2. Easy to implement and use
Online CRM systems are designed to be user-friendly and require little to no IT expertise to use. They often come with customizable templates and workflows that can be easily adapted to meet a business's specific needs. This makes it easy for businesses to implement the system quickly and start seeing results right away.
3. Enhanced collaboration
Online CRM systems allow multiple teams to access and update customer data in real-time. This enhances collaboration between sales, marketing, and customer service teams, leading to more effective customer engagement and increased revenue.
4. Scalable
Online CRM systems can grow with a business. As a business's customer base expands, the system can be easily scaled up to accommodate the increase in data. This eliminates the need for businesses to invest in a new system every time they experience growth.
How an online CRM system works
An online CRM system works by centralizing customer data in a cloud-based database. The system can be accessed from anywhere with an internet connection, making it easy for sales teams to access customer data on the go. Online CRM systems typically include the following features:
1. Contact management
Contact management allows businesses to store and manage customer data in a centralized location. This includes contact information, communication history, and purchase history. Contact management allows businesses to better understand their customers and improve their engagement strategies.
2. Sales management
Sales management allows businesses to track their sales pipeline and manage their sales team's performance. This includes lead tracking, opportunity management, and sales forecasting. Sales management helps businesses identify areas for improvement and optimize their sales processes.
3. Marketing automation
Marketing automation allows businesses to automate their marketing processes, such as email campaigns and social media outreach. This helps businesses engage with customers more effectively and improve their marketing ROI.
4. Customer service management
Customer service management allows businesses to track and manage customer service inquiries. This includes ticketing systems, knowledge bases, and chatbots. Customer service management helps businesses provide better customer service and improve customer satisfaction.
Choosing the right online CRM system
Choosing the right online CRM system can be overwhelming. When evaluating different options, businesses should consider the following factors:
1. Ease of use
Businesses should look for a system that is easy to use and requires little to no IT expertise. This will ensure that the system can be implemented quickly and used effectively.
2. Customization options
Businesses should look for a system that can be customized to meet their specific needs. This includes customizable workflows, templates, and reports.
3. Integrations
Businesses should look for a system that can integrate with their existing software, such as email marketing tools and e-commerce platforms. This will ensure that customer data can be easily shared across different systems.
4. Scalability
Businesses should look for a system that can grow with their business. This includes the ability to add new users, features, and data storage.
